An undersprung door is heavier than the spring counterbalances in Flowing Wells, AZ. The opener motor runs against the uncounterbalanced weight on every opening cycle in Flowing Wells. The motor draws more current than its design rating in Flowing Wells, AZ. The drive gear meshes against the worm gear under more torque than its design rating in Flowing Wells. The cables carry more tension than their design specification in Flowing Wells, AZ. All four components accumulate wear faster than they would under correct spring tension in Flowing Wells. A spring replaced with the wrong specification at $150 to $250 produces $300 to $600 in premature component failures over the following 12 to 24 months in Flowing Wells, AZ.

The bracket adjustment test takes sixty to ninety seconds in Flowing Wells. The receiver sensor bracket is adjusted through its complete range of angles while the receiver LED is observed in Flowing Wells, AZ. If the LED becomes solid at any angle, the sensor is functional and was only misaligned in Flowing Wells. The bracket is locked in the correct position and no sensor replacement is needed in Flowing Wells, AZ. A sensor replacement without this test has a significant probability of replacing a functional sensor that was simply misaligned in Flowing Wells. That replacement costs $75 to $150 in Flowing Wells, AZ. The bracket adjustment test that would have prevented it takes sixty to ninety seconds in Flowing Wells.
